1. Trang chủ
  2. » Công Nghệ Thông Tin

Đề thi cơ sở dữ liệu và giải thuật

7 16 0

Đang tải... (xem toàn văn)

THÔNG TIN TÀI LIỆU

Thông tin cơ bản

Định dạng
Số trang 7
Dung lượng 35,5 KB

Nội dung

Tham khảo tài liệu ''đề thi cơ sở dữ liệu và giải thuật'', công nghệ thông tin, kỹ thuật lập trình phục vụ nhu cầu học tập, nghiên cứu và làm việc hiệu quả

Câu : (3 điểm) Giả sử tồn nhị phân tìm kiếm (CNPTK) T nhớ, có liệu phần tử điểm mặt phẳng sau: CODE struct point { int x,y; }; struct BSTree { Node Root; }; struct tagNode { point data; tagNode *Left, *Right; }; typedef tagNode *Node; Anh (chị) : a) Nhập vào số thực a, tìm phần tử b T mà b có x gần a (dùng fasb để lấy giá trị tuyệt đối số thực) b) Cho biết cặp điểm gần T Câu : (4 điểm) Trên mặt phẳng Oxy có hình vng C, ta chia hình vng C thành 04 hình vng C1, C2, C3, C4 Trong hình vng Ci (i = 1, 2, 3, 4) ta lại chia thành 04 hình vng nhỏ hình vng tơ màu xanh, đỏ, tím, vàng (theo thứ tự hình vẽ) Q tình chia nhỏ kết thúc diện tích nhỏ a (cho trước) Anh (chị) xây dựng cấu trúc liệu động để lưu trữ hình vng thuật tốn để xây dựng hình vng CODE _ | | | | | | | Xanh | Đỏ | | | | | | | | | _| | | | | | | | Tím | Vàng | | | | | | | | | _| a) Hãy cho biết có số lần phải chia b) Hãy cho biết có hình vng có diện tích nhỏ b (cho trước) Hết Cài đặt giải thuật xếp : nhị phân, Bubble sort, Select sort, Insert sort, Heap sort, Quick sort Cài đặt thuật toán tìm kiếm nhị phân - Binary Search Chương trình đổi số, cài đặt stack Bài toán Josephus : có N người định tự sát tập thể cách đứng vòng tròn giết người thứ M quanh vòng tròn, thu hẹp hàng ngũ lại người ngã khỏi vòng tròn Vấn đề tìm thứ tự người bị giết Ví dụ : N = 9, M = thứ tự 5, 1, 7, 4, 3, 6, 9, 2, Hãy viết chương trình giải tốn Josephus Chọn cấu trúc thích hợp để lưu trữ đa thức với hệ số khác 0, khơng cần nhập theo thứ tự bậc Viết chương trình tính tổng, tích đa thức, tìm thương phần dư phép chia đa thức, tính đạo hàm đa thức (Có thể cho phép hệ số phân số) Một danh sách sinh viên tổ chức lưu trữ cấu trúc danh sách liên kết, phần tử bao gồm thành phần sau int MASO char *HOTEN float DIEMTOAN, DIEMVAN, DIEMLY Viết hàm thực chức sau: Nhập xuất, ghi liệu vào file, đọc liệu từ file Thêm, xố sinh viên Tìm kiếm sinh viên theo mã số, theo điểm trung bình Sắp xếp sv theo mã số Sắp xếp sv theo điểm từ cao xuống thấp, xếp loại, xếp hạng, loại giỏi đến trung bình yếu điểm trung bình < 5.0 : Yếu < =6.5 : Nếu có mơn : Yếu, ngược lại Trung Bình < 8.0 : Nếu có mơn =8.0 : Nếu có mơn

Ngày đăng: 11/05/2021, 02:32

TỪ KHÓA LIÊN QUAN

w